CSD18533Q5A Frequently Asked Questions (FAQs)

  • A good PCB layout for the CSD18533Q5A involves keeping the high-current paths short and wide, using multiple vias to connect the thermal pad to the heat sink, and placing the input capacitors close to the device. A 4-layer PCB with a solid ground plane is recommended.
  • To ensure stability, ensure that the input and output capacitors meet the recommended specifications, the input voltage is within the recommended range, and the device is properly decoupled from the power source. Additionally, a minimum ESR of 10mΩ is recommended for the output capacitor.
  • The maximum ambient temperature for the CSD18533Q5A is 105°C. However, the device can operate up to 150°C junction temperature, but this may affect its reliability and lifespan.
  • Yes, the CSD18533Q5A is suitable for high-reliability applications. It is manufactured using a high-reliability process and is qualified to automotive and industrial standards. However, it is essential to follow proper design and manufacturing guidelines to ensure the device operates within its specifications.
  • To troubleshoot issues with the CSD18533Q5A, start by verifying the input voltage, output voltage, and current. Check for overheating, incorrect PCB layout, or inadequate decoupling. Use an oscilloscope to check for voltage ripple, noise, or oscillations. Consult the datasheet and application notes for guidance on troubleshooting specific issues.

About Texas Instruments

Texas Instruments (TI) designs and manufactures semiconductors and integrated circuits for a wide range of applications. The company's product portfolio includes analog chips, which are essential for managing power and signal functions in electronic devices, and embedded processors, which serve as the brains in various systems, enabling functionality in everything from industrial equipment to consumer electronics. TI's innovations in semiconductor technology have made it a leader in the industry.
